IT Help Desk Technician (230231)

With a high degree of privacy, security and professionalism, provide necessary technical services and support in a consistent and timely manner to Consumer Cellular’s management staff, employees, and partners. Ensure Consumer Cellular Inc’s (CCI) mission critical infrastructure, systems, and applications maintain a high level of stability, availability, and performance to support CCI’s Contact Center Operations, and various 24/7/365 business functions.


Responsibilities:

  • Monitor and respond quickly, effectively, and professionally to requests and issues, partnering as needed with other IT team members
  • Work independently to stay on task, prioritize urgent issues, and send communications to the necessary parties
  • Utilize standard IT Request Management software to record, monitor, redirect, and escalate tickets assigned to the queue and process first-in first-out based on priority
  • Utilize standard IT Wiki software to document processes, procedures, systems, and services, to preserve and grow Help Desk knowledge, and maintain inventory of all equipment, software, and software licenses
  • Ensure that each workstation in the facility has a working computer, monitor, keyboard, mouse, phone, and any additional specialized equipment
  • Install, configure, maintain, and repair IT equipment following IT standard processes and procedures; assist remote users that are using company-issued equipment and telephony devices
  • Assist users across all levels of the organization with both onsite and remote work, troubleshoot technical issues, and collaborate with other team members when needed
  • Perform assigned activities and tasks on schedule following IT standard processes and procedures
  • Produce activity reports as needed
  • Periodically learn new technical skills on the job, and attend relevant training throughout the calendar year

Qualifications:

  • Associates or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science preferred
  • Microsoft Office (Word, Outlook, Excel) and/or Microsoft 365 experience
  • Ability to complete basic desktop and laptop PC/Mac troubleshooting, including new set up and swapping out cables, RAM, and peripherals
  • Basic knowledge of printer set up and troubleshooting
  • Familiarity with Microsoft Windows Command-Line, Powershell, and task automation
  • Active Directory and Group Policy familiarity
  • Web Browser Configuration Experience: Internet Explorer, Edge, Chrome, Firefox, Safari, etc.
  • Familiarity with Server and Network terminology
  • PC and/or Mac imaging, configuration, and repair experience
  • Ability to effectively communicate and troubleshoot with non-technical end users across all levels of the organization while maintaining both a sense of urgency, and a calm and professional demeanor
  • Maintain CCI Core Values when performing job functions and when interacting with CCI staff and partners
  • Ability to work remotely and onsite with equal effectiveness
  • Occasional after-hours work required
